Full job description

NVIDIA is looking for an AI Solutions Architect with deep, hands-on experience in large-scale GPU systems. This role involves working with some of the world’s leading consumer internet companies and frontier labs building foundation models. Primary responsibilities include accelerating customer workloads, designing high-performance AI infrastructure, and leading technical engagements around NVIDIA technologies. We work with the world’s most successful technology companies, uniquely positioning you to observe and influence emerging infrastructure trends using the latest advancements. Join us in this exciting endeavor!

What You’ll Be Doing:

  • Collaborating closely with customers to maximize GPU utilization and end-to-end workload throughput while improving infrastructure reliability and reducing infrastructure costs.

  • Designing and optimizing large-scale AI clusters across GPU compute, high-performance networking, storage, workload scheduling, orchestration, and observability.

  • Profiling distributed training and inference workloads to identify bottlenecks across GPUs, CPUs, memory, network fabrics, storage systems, and software stack.

  • Diagnosing complex infrastructure and distributed systems issues spanning InfiniBand and RoCE fabrics, cloud interconnects, RDMA, NCCL, NVLink, and NVSwitch.

  • Leading proof-of-concepts and performance studies for large-scale AI infrastructure, developing benchmarking tools, automation, runbooks, and technical collateral as needed.

  • Partnering with NVIDIA’s engineering, product, and sales teams to secure design wins and drive innovative solutions based on customer requirements and field feedback.

What We Need To See:

  • BS, MS, or PhD in Computer Science, Electrical/Computer Engineering, Physics, Mathematics, or another Engineering field, or equivalent experience.

  • 6+ years of experience in AI infrastructure, systems engineering, high-performance computing, networking, site reliability engineering, or a related technical role.

  • Deep understanding of Linux systems, distributed computing, GPU architectures, and the hardware and software components of large-scale AI clusters.

  • Hands-on experience designing, deploying, operating, or troubleshooting high-performance GPU networks in on-premises or cloud environments using technologies such as InfiniBand, RoCE, or GPUDirect RDMA.

  • Experience debugging NCCL communication and distributed collective performance, including topology, transport, congestion, routing, and host-level configuration issues.

  • Experience profiling AI workloads and identifying performance bottlenecks across compute, networking, storage, and orchestration layers.

  • Experience with cluster schedulers and orchestration platforms such as Kubernetes and Slurm, along with containers and production monitoring systems.

  • Proficiency with Python, shell scripting, or similar languages for infrastructure automation, benchmarking, and systems troubleshooting.

Ways To Stand Out From The Crowd:

  • Experience architecting and operating large-scale production GPU clusters for distributed training or inference.

  • Deep expertise with NVIDIA infrastructure technologies such as DGX/HGX systems, NVLink, NVSwitch, NCCL, InfiniBand, and Spectrum-X.

  • Hands-on experience using tools and telemetry such as NCCL tests, DCGM, Nsight Systems, fabric counters, and host- or switch-level diagnostics to isolate performance and reliability issues.

  • Understanding of network topology, congestion control, collective communication patterns, and their impact on distributed AI workload performance.

  • Experience optimizing storage and data pipelines to sustain high-throughput training and inference workloads.
